Miniature Highland Cattle: Selecting the Ideal Calf

When hunting for your perfect Miniature Highland calf, it's essential to consider several key factors. First and foremost, you want a calf that is healthy. Look for bright gaze, shiny coat, and a cheerful temperament. A good Miniature Highland calf will also be approachable with people and other animals.

Beyond physical health, consider the calf's build. Look for straight legs, a balanced topline, and a well-proportioned head. It's also important to choose a calf from a reputable breeder who focuses on health and temperament.

Finally, don't forget to pick a calf that you connect with.

Bring your family along and let everyone meet the calves. Choose the calf that makes your heart smile.

Choosing a Healthy & Happy Mini Highland Calf

When bringing home your very own Mini Highland calf, it's essential to select one that is both healthy and happy. A healthy calf will have clear eyes, a smooth coat, and look alert and energetic. They should also be consuming their feed sufficiently and thriving.

A happy calf will be spirited, exploring its surroundings, and happy to interact with you. Observe their behavior and notice for signs of happiness. A happy calf will show cheerful body language, such as a moving tail and relaxed ears.

Remember, bringing home a Mini Highland calf is a big commitment. Take your time to select the perfect calf that will provide you years of joy and companionship.

Tips for Selecting the Top Mini Highland for You

Bringing home a miniature Highland cow is an exciting decision! These charming creatures make wonderful companions and are sure to bring joy to your life. But before you welcome one into your herd, it's important to consider what kind of mini Highland would be the ideal fit for you and your lifestyle. Do you want a calm companion or a more spirited personality? Will this mini Highland be primarily a pet?

  • First, think about your familiarity with cattle. Mini Highlands are generally docile, but they still require care and attention. If you're a first-time owner, talk to breeders to ensure you're prepared for the responsibility.
  • Next, consider your available space. While mini Highlands are smaller than their standard counterparts, they still need room to roam. Make sure you have adequate pasture or paddock space to provide them with a comfortable environment.
  • Ultimately, don't forget to interact with potential mini Highlands before making a decision. This will give you a chance to judge their temperament and see if they are a good match for your family and lifestyle.
